What Is an Affidavit of Legal Guardianship?

An affidavit of legal guardianship is a sworn statement, usually written and notarized, that

formally asserts a person’s status as a guardian. This document is often required to prove

your authority to make decisions on behalf of someone who cannot legally represent

themselves, such as a minor child or an incapacitated adult.

Unlike a court order, an affidavit can sometimes be a simpler way to demonstrate

guardianship in situations where formal guardianship has already been established by a

court or where temporary guardianship is needed. It’s a powerful legal instrument that

confirms your role and responsibilities.

Key Elements of an Affidavit of Legal Guardianship Sample

When reviewing or drafting an affidavit of legal guardianship sample, it’s important to

ensure it contains certain critical information:

**Guardian’s Full Name and Contact Information:** Clearly stating who the guardian

is.

**Ward’s Information:** Details of the individual under guardianship, including their

full name, date of birth, and relationship to the guardian.

**Statement of Guardianship:** A declaration that the affiant (the person making

the affidavit) is the legal guardian.

**Scope of Guardianship:** Descriptions of the rights and responsibilities held, such

as medical decisions, education, and financial management.

**Duration:** The time period during which guardianship is effective.

**Legal Authority:** Reference to any court orders or legal documents that grant

guardianship.

**Notarization:** A section for a notary public to validate the affidavit.

Including these elements ensures your affidavit is clear, legally sound, and readily

accepted by institutions like schools, hospitals, or government agencies.

Why You Might Need an Affidavit of Legal Guardianship

Legal guardianship is a serious responsibility, and the affidavit functions as proof of your

legal authority. Here are some common scenarios where an affidavit of legal guardianship

sample can be invaluable:

**Enrolling a Child in School:** Schools often require proof that the person enrolling

the child has legal guardianship.

**Medical Decisions:** Hospitals and medical providers may ask for guardianship

documentation before allowing you to make healthcare decisions.

**Travel Authorization:** When traveling with a minor, especially internationally, an

affidavit may be required to prove you have the right to accompany and care for the

child.

**Financial Matters:** Banks and financial institutions might need to verify your

guardianship status before you can manage accounts or assets on behalf of the

ward.

**Emergency Situations:** In urgent cases, an affidavit can serve as immediate

proof of guardianship before formal paperwork is processed.

Temporary vs. Permanent Guardianship

It’s important to distinguish between temporary and permanent guardianship when

drafting your affidavit. Temporary guardianship is often granted for short periods, such as

when parents are traveling or unavailable. Permanent guardianship usually follows a court

process and lasts until the ward reaches the age of majority or is otherwise deemed

capable of self-care.

Your affidavit should clearly state the type of guardianship it covers and the applicable

time frame. This clarity helps avoid confusion and ensures the affidavit serves its intended

purpose.

How to Write an Effective Affidavit of Legal Guardianship Sample

Drafting an affidavit may seem daunting, but following a straightforward process can

make it manageable. Here are some practical tips for writing an affidavit of legal

guardianship that will stand up to scrutiny:

1. Use Clear and Precise Language

Legal documents benefit from clarity. Avoid ambiguous terms and ensure every sentence

conveys exactly what you mean. For example, instead of vague phrases like “I may take

care of,” specify “I have the legal authority to make medical, educational, and financial

decisions on behalf of [Ward’s Name].”

2. Include All Necessary Details

Double-check that you’ve included all relevant personal information and legal references.

Missing details can delay acceptance of your affidavit or cause legal complications.

3. Reference Supporting Documents

If your guardianship is backed by a court order or another legal document, mention this

explicitly. You may want to attach copies of these documents when submitting your

affidavit.

4. Sign and Notarize Properly

An affidavit is only legally valid if signed in front of a notary public. Don’t sign the

document beforehand. Locate a notary, bring valid identification, and complete the

notarization process as required by your jurisdiction.

5. Keep Copies for Your Records

Once notarized, make several copies of your affidavit. Provide the original or certified

copies to entities that request proof of guardianship, but always keep one for your files.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Preparing an Affidavit of Legal

Guardianship

Navigating legal documents can be tricky. Here are some pitfalls to watch out for:

**Omitting Notarization:** Without notarization, your affidavit may be considered

invalid.

**Inaccurate Information:** Double-check names, dates, and court references to

avoid errors.

**Using Informal Language:** Keep your tone professional and legal in nature.

**Failing to Attach Supporting Documents:** Attach copies of court orders or

guardianship letters to strengthen your affidavit.

**Not Updating the Affidavit:** If your guardianship status changes, update your

affidavit promptly and notify relevant parties.

Legal Context and Usage

An affidavit of legal guardianship sample is frequently used in situations where a guardian

needs to prove their authority without producing a full court order. For example, schools

often require such affidavits to enroll a child when the guardian is not a parent. Similarly,

hospitals may request this documentation before administering medical treatment.

It is important to note that while an affidavit can provide temporary evidence of

guardianship, many institutions may still require official court orders or letters of

guardianship for full legal recognition. Therefore, affidavits often serve as supplemental

documents rather than standalone proof in complex legal matters.

Advantages and Limitations of Using an Affidavit of Legal Guardianship

The affidavit of legal guardianship sample offers several benefits:

Convenience: It provides a quick, accessible way to demonstrate guardianship

1.

without producing lengthy court documents.

Legal Weight: When properly executed, it holds significant legal value as a sworn

2.

statement.

Flexibility: Can be tailored to specify the scope of guardianship relevant to

3.

particular situations.

However, some limitations must be acknowledged:

Potential Challenges: Some institutions may require formal court orders and do

1.

not accept affidavits alone.

Jurisdictional Differences: Not all jurisdictions recognize affidavits as sufficient

2.

proof of guardianship.

Temporary Nature: Affidavits may serve as interim proof but do not replace

3.

formal legal documentation in long-term guardianship cases.

Understanding these pros and cons helps guardians and legal advisors determine when an

affidavit is appropriate and when additional legal steps are necessary.

Comparing Affidavit of Legal Guardianship with Other

Guardianship Documents

Legal guardianship can be established through various documents and court orders, each

serving different purposes:

Letters of Guardianship: Issued by the court, these formal letters certify a

1.

guardian’s appointment and are often required for official matters.

Guardianship Orders: Court-issued orders that specify the terms and conditions of

2.

guardianship.

Power of Attorney: Sometimes used for temporary guardianship, though generally

3.

not suitable for minors.

Affidavit of Guardianship: Typically a sworn statement used to supplement or

4.

provide interim proof.

While affidavits are less formal than court orders or letters of guardianship, they are

valuable in scenarios needing immediate, accessible proof of guardianship.
